Gatsby advanced starter

How does a typical dynamic website, like those based on WordPress, work? When a visitor enters the URL on a browser or visits your website through a link, a request is sent to your web server. The server gathers the required data through necessary database queries and generates an HTML file for your browser to display. Static sites, on the other hand, store these responses into flat files on the server that are instantly delivered to a visitor. Static site generators have been around for a long time, but they have grown in popularity recently.

In this step-by-step guide, we look at the integration of WordPress with Gatsbya static site generator. It is possible to create a static version of WordPress by generating a list of HTML pages for all the content on your site.

This conversion process is done just once so that the same page can be served to visitors multiple times.

Gatsby v2 Casper Starter

How do you convert your WordPress site to a static version? This is where Gatsby comes into the picture.

gatsby advanced starter

Gatsby allows anyone to create feature-rich, engaging websites and applications. Gatsby fetches data for your site from a variety of sources including existing websites, API calls and flat files through GraphQL, and builds the static site based on configuration settings specified by you. Gatsby was developed only a year ago, but a large number of users are giving Gatsby a try. Gatsby has found acceptance in a variety of settings. Its Canadian site is hosted with Gatsby, while search function on the site is powered by React.

Portfolio such as the one by Jacob Castro have primarily static content with links to works and contact through email, thus making a static site a perfect fit for his needs. Load times also affect page views and conversions.

2012 dodge charger engine diagram

Additionally, you can always re-generate the static files if they are lost. Server Costs: Hosting a dynamic site requires your server to be compatible with your technology stack. If you are working with a static site, you can host it on almost any server, which brings down the cost associated with hosting too.

Generating the static site with Gatsby on every change does need JavaScript, which may be also done on a local machine before transferring the static files to the site. For example, comments need to be hosted externally through a service like Disqus. Contact forms would also need to be re-routed through an external partner like Google Forms.

In short, you would lose direct control over such dynamic content, as their responses are not stored on your servers. Any change that you do on your site is only reflected once you have regenerated the pages and re-uploaded them on the server. Some knowledge of JavaScript and a basic idea of GraphQL, therefore, is needed to work with and port a website to Gatsby.

Static websites are good for those who are looking for a low-cost solution, with high security. Some use cases are portfolio websites for freelancers and product demo sites.The Gatsby CLI tool lets you install starterswhich are boilerplate Gatsby sites maintained by the community and intended for jump-starting development quickly.

gatsby advanced starter

Execute the gatsby new command to clone a boilerplate starter, install its dependencies, and clear Git history. When creating a new Gatsby site, you can optionally specify a starter to base your new site on; they can come from any publicly available Git repo, such as GitHub, GitLab, or Bitbucket. This downloads the files and initializes the site by running npm install. This also downloads the files and initializes the site by running npm install.

Note: If you work for an Enterprise-level company where you are unable to pull from public GitHub repositories, you can still set up Gatsby.

How the dumper feels during no contact reddit

Check out the docs to learn more. Another option is to supply a path relative or absolute to a local folder containing a starter:. Here is an example assuming a starter exists on the path. Learn how to modify a starter in the Gatsby docs. You can use official and community starters out of the box but you may want to customize their style and functionality.

Learn how to make a starter in the Gatsby docs. Starters can be created for your team s only or distributed to the broader community. Installing starters Execute the gatsby new command to clone a boilerplate starter, install its dependencies, and clear Git history.

gatsby advanced starter

Using a local starter Another option is to supply a path relative or absolute to a local folder containing a starter: Here is an example assuming a starter exists on the path. Making starters Learn how to make a starter in the Gatsby docs. Community starters Community starters are created and maintained by Gatsby community members.

Looking for a starter for a particular use case? Browse starters that have been submitted to the Starter Library. Follow these steps to submit your starter to the Starter Library. Edit this page on GitHub.

Previous Conventions. Next Starter Library.Upgrade dependencies. Fix Schema. Fixes Add pagination documentation. Make paging optional. Update dependencies. Upgrade packages to their latest versions. Improve NetlifyCMS documentation. Add gatsby-remark-relative-images to fix relative image path resoluti… ….

Implement RSS feed title setting. Upgrade packages. Actually rely directly on Gatsby instead of yarn during Netlify builds. Rely directly on Gatsby instead of yarn during Netlify builds.

Update package-lock.

Build an Ecommerce Site Using Stripe and Gatsby — Learn With Jason

Update netlify. Update yarn.

Onan oil filter cross reference

Update lodash to fix security issues. Update pagination paths to fix gatsby-link errors.

greg lobinski

Update siteUrl. Fix UserLinks not working. Fix missing footer. Update robots. Update pathPrefix for Netlify deploys. Skip to content.

Permalink Branch: master. Commits on Jun 6, Vagr9K committed Jun 6, This commit was created on GitHub.G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.

If nothing happens, download GitHub Desktop and try again. If nothing happens, download Xcode and try again. If nothing happens, download the GitHub extension for Visual Studio and try again. A starter skeleton with advanced features for Gatsby.

To get the Gatsby v1 compatible version, use the v1 branch. Check out the Features to read about all Progressive Web App capabilities of this starter in detail. If you are a newcomer to Gatsby who's interested in the implementations of most needed features, this is a great place to start. If you are interested in a foundation for building ultra-fast websites, you can use this project as a "minimal" starter. Install this starter assuming Gatsby is installed and updated by running from your CLI:.

If want to customize Netlify CMS, e.

Intro to Building Websites with Gatsby and WordPress (Fast and Static)

By default the starter will show 4 posts per page. In this case the landing page will be controlled by the Landing component. For NetlifyCMS specific issues visit the official documentation. Skip to content. MIT License. Dismiss Join GitHub today G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. Sign up. Branch: master. Go back. Launching Xcode If nothing happens, download Xcode and try again.

Latest commit. Vagr9K committed d Jun 6, Git stats commits 9 branches 4 tags. Failed to load latest commit information. View code. Preferably should be under 12 characters to prevent truncation. For cases when deployed to example. Set to zero to disable paging. See the "Pagination" section. Especially dogs.

Dogs are the best. Every time you come home, they act like they haven't seen you in a year. And the good thing about dogs Make sure to replace with your repo! Jun 1, You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window.G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. If nothing happens, download GitHub Desktop and try again. If nothing happens, download Xcode and try again.

If nothing happens, download the GitHub extension for Visual Studio and try again. A blog starter for Gatsbyutilizing the popular Casper v1. The project is based on Gatsby Advanced Starter and has a lot on common with the Gatsby Material Starterbut will evolve separately.

In this project the single Casper CSS file has been carefully extracted into individual components with only minor tweaks. This starter also serves as example for the Gatsby-Pagination library. More information on Gatsby can be found here. Thus, GatsbyJS v1 support can be found in 1.

Open casket gone wrong

Special thanks to hnspn for migration the project to support Gatsby v2. Install this starter assuming Gatsby is installed by running from your CLI:. Each post should have a separate folder for the. Each post can reference the author of the post, if the author is not set the default author will be used; which is controlled by the blogAuthorId property in SiteConfig. The location of this authors folder can be controlled by the blogAuthorDir property in SiteConfig.

It IS possible to have the authors folder inside the blogPostDir folder. The project uses Conventional Commits which are simple and easy to follow.

In general, use your best judgment, and feel free to propose changes by creating an issue and then mention the issue in your pull request.

gatsby advanced starter

Skip to content. The Casper theme v1. MIT License. Dismiss Join GitHub today G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. Sign up. Branch: master. Go back. Launching Xcode If nothing happens, download Xcode and try again. Latest commit. Git stats commits 25 branches 10 tags. Failed to load latest commit information. View code. For cases when deployed to example.

About The Casper theme v1. Releases 10 tags. Contributors 5. You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window.Start to write your library documentation or your design system with Docz and Gatsby in a very simple way with this starter. This starter was made to help you present your ideas easier. We all know how hard is to start something on the web, especially these days. A gatsbyjs starter forked from gatsby-starter-blog and applied overreacted lookings, with tags and breadcrumbs, eslint supported.

Developer Diary is a Gatsby Starter blog template created with web developers in mind, but really, anyone can use it. Syntax theme based on Sarah Drasner's Night Owl with small tweaks.

A custom, image-centric theme for Gatsby. Made for publishers and portfolios with plenty of graphics to show off to the world. Kick off your project with this blog boilerplate. This starter ships with the main Gatsby configuration files you might need to get up and running blazing fast with the blazing fast app generator for React. JAM stack implementation of Humble Ghost theme.

Opensuse disable firewall

This project is based on Gastby Starter Ghost. A blog starter with advanced features for Gatsby. Built on Gatsby-Advanced-Starter.

A Gatsby starter template based on gatsby-starter-blog and inspired by Facebook design blog. Gatsby starter for creating a blog powered by Ghost. This project with styled-components shows off a minimalist blog layout. This is a site built with Gatsby. Blog Starter Pack based on gatsby-starter-blog.

Gatsby V2 Starter - product of step by step tutorial. A Gatsby starter to get you started creating educational materials using Markdown.G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.

If nothing happens, download GitHub Desktop and try again. If nothing happens, download Xcode and try again. If nothing happens, download the GitHub extension for Visual Studio and try again. Skip to content. MIT License. Dismiss Join GitHub today G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.

Sign up. Branch: master. Go back. Launching Xcode If nothing happens, download Xcode and try again. Latest commit. Git stats 10 commits 3 branches 0 tags. Failed to load latest commit information. View code. Gatsbyjs blog advanced starter with seo,tags,sitemaps and best practices Tutorials Table of contents Introduction to Gatsby Getting started with Gatsby Adding blog posts Display the posts list Creating the template for the blog posts Adding images Prev and next links Tags Seo Share icons Bonus Install Make sure that you have the Gatsby CLI program installed: npm install --global gatsby-cli.

About gatsby-advanced-starter for creating blog gatsby-advanced-blog. Releases No releases published. You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window.


thoughts on “Gatsby advanced starter

Leave a Reply

Your email address will not be published. Required fields are marked *